Building Data Science Applications with FastAPI

Building Data Science Applications with FastAPI

François Voron

80,53 €
IVA incluido
Disponible
Editorial:
Packt Publishing
Año de edición:
2021
ISBN:
9781801079211
80,53 €
IVA incluido
Disponible

Selecciona una librería:

  • Librería Samer Atenea
  • Librería Aciertas (Toledo)
  • Kálamo Books
  • Librería Perelló (Valencia)
  • Librería Elías (Asturias)
  • Donde los libros
  • Librería Kolima (Madrid)
  • Librería Proteo (Málaga)

Get well-versed with FastAPI features and best practices for testing, monitoring, and deployment to run high-quality and robust data science applicationsKey Features:Cover the concepts of the FastAPI framework, including aspects relating to asynchronous programming, type hinting, and dependency injectionDevelop efficient RESTful APIs for data science with modern PythonBuild, test, and deploy high performing data science and machine learning systems with FastAPIBook Description:FastAPI is a web framework for building APIs with Python 3.6 and its later versions based on standard Python-type hints. With this book, you’ll be able to create fast and reliable data science API backends using practical examples.This book starts with the basics of the FastAPI framework and associated modern Python programming language concepts. You’ll then be taken through all the aspects of the framework, including its powerful dependency injection system and how you can use it to communicate with databases, implement authentication and integrate machine learning models. Later, you’ll cover best practices relating to testing and deployment to run a high-quality and robust application. You’ll also be introduced to the extensive ecosystem of Python data science packages. As you progress, you’ll learn how to build data science applications in Python using FastAPI. The book also demonstrates how to develop fast and efficient machine learning prediction backends and test them to achieve the best performance. Finally, you’ll see how to implement a real-time face detection system using WebSockets and a web browser as a client.By the end of this FastAPI book, you’ll have not only learned how to implement Python in data science projects but also how to maintain and design them to meet high programming standards with the help of FastAPI.What You Will Learn:Explore the basics of modern Python and async I/O programmingGet to grips with basic and advanced concepts of the FastAPI frameworkImplement a FastAPI dependency to efficiently run a machine learning modelIntegrate a simple face detection algorithm in a FastAPI backendIntegrate common Python data science libraries in a web backendDeploy a performant and reliable web backend for a data science applicationWho this book is for:This Python data science book is for data scientists and software developers interested in gaining knowledge of FastAPI and its ecosystem to build data science applications. Basic knowledge of data science and machine learning concepts and how to apply them in Python is recommended.

Artículos relacionados

  • 'Careers in Information Technology
    Patrick Mukosha
    In 'Careers in Information Technology: Data Scientist,' readers embark on a comprehensive journey into the dynamic world of data science. Authored by an experienced IT expert, this book serves as a roadmap for aspiring data scientists, offering valuable insights into the roles, responsibilities, and opportunities within the field. The book begins by introducing the fundamental ...
    Disponible

    18,63 €

  • Advances in Data Science and Computing Technology
    This volume helps to address the genuine 21st century need for advances in data science and computing technology. It provides an abundance of new research and studies on progressive and innovative technologies, including artificial intelligence, communication systems, cyber security applications, data analytics, Internet of Things (IoT), machine learning, power systems, VLSI, e...
  • Partial Differential Equations for Geometric Design
    Hassan Ugail
    Elementary Mathematics for Geometric Design.-Introduction to Geometric Design.-Introduction to Partial Differential Equations.-Elliptic PDEs for Geometric Design.-Interactive Design.-Parametric Design.-Functional Design.-Other Applications.-Conclusions. ...
  • Windows Phone Application Sketch Book
    Dean Kaplan
    Think you have the next great Windows Phone app idea? The Windows Phone Application Sketch Book is an essential tool for any aspiring Windows Phone developer. This sketch book makes it easy to centralize and organize your ideas, featuring enlarged Windows Phone templates to write on. Professionally printed on high-quality paper, it has a total of 150 gridded templates for you t...
    Disponible

    18,42 €

  • Appreneur
    Taylor Pierce
    You are interested in making an app. You have read all of the stories of successful developers and appreneurs. You are determined to get a piece of the pie. The world of apps is the fastest growing market in the world today, and it is here to stay. The best part is you can get in on it! Now what if I told you that without the knowledge contained in this book the odds of you mak...
    Disponible

    39,93 €

  • iPad Application Sketch Book
    Dean Kaplan
    ...
    Disponible

    18,42 €

Otros libros del autor

  • Building Data Science Applications with FastAPI - Second Edition
    François Voron
    Learn all the features and best practices of FastAPI to build, deploy, and monitor powerful data science and AI apps, like object detection or image generation.Purchase of the print or Kindle book includes a free PDF eBookKey Features:Uncover the secrets of FastAPI, including async I/O, type hinting, and dependency injectionLearn to add authentication, authorization, and intera...
    Disponible

    87,26 €